All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/nc/ncfiles.htm ************************************************ File contributed for use in USGenWeb Archives by: Derick Hartshorn DerickH@charter.net March 19, 2005, 9:00 am Source: Old St. Pauls Cemetery, Newton, NC Photo can be seen at: http://www.usgwarchives.net/nc/catawba/killian/killian01.htm Image file size: 42.7 Kb In Memory of Andreas Killian 1702- 1788 His Wife Mary, And Twelve Children As Named In His Will: Margaret George Leonard Brina John Daniel Jean Samuel C. Crate Christianna Our pioneer ancestor came from Germany on the ship Adventure, landing at Philadelphia where he took The oath of allegiance September 23, 1732. He came to North Carolina about 1747 and later Established a home about two miles northwest of here.
